Ferry
From Sliema, head to the Sliema Ferry Terminal located along the waterfront. You can walk along the promenade if you're near the main shopping area. Once at the terminal, board the ferry heading to Valletta. The ferry ride takes about 10-15 minutes, offering beautiful views of the Grand Harbour. Once you arrive at the Valletta Ferry Terminal, exit the terminal and follow the signs towards the city.
Walking
After disembarking from the ferry at Valletta, walk up towards the main streets. You can take the main street, Republic Street, which is straight ahead as you exit the terminal. Continue walking straight until you reach St. George's Square. From there, take a right onto St. Dominic Street. The Valletta Black Friars Experience will be on your left. It’s approximately a 10-minute walk from the ferry terminal.
Public Bus
If you prefer to take a bus, from Sliema, walk to the nearest bus stop located along the main road. Board the bus (Route 130 is a good option) heading towards Valletta. The bus journey will take around 20-30 minutes. Once you arrive at the Valletta bus terminal, exit the bus and walk towards the city center, following the same route as mentioned above via Republic Street. Head to St. George's Square, then turn right onto St. Dominic Street to reach your destination.
